Gautam Gambhir endorses Zaheer Khan for Team India coaching role - Here's what he said!

New Delhi: Not many believed Zaheer Khan was the right man to lead Delhi Daredevils in the ninth edition of the Indian Premier League.

However, Zak has done a phenomenal job with the young DD side and the results are there for everyone to see.

It is no secret that the former left-arm pacer boasts of a sharp cricketing acumen and was even jokingly nicknamed 'gyan baba' in the Indian dressing room.

On Monday, Zak's former teammate Gautam Gambhir endorsed the DD skipper for a coaching role with the Indian national team.

The BCCI has still not finalized on the candidate for the top job, but Gambhir feels Zak should be considered for the role.

"I remember reading one of Harsha Bhogle’s recent columns in which he suggested Zaheer Khan isn’t too far from becoming the coach of the India team. I agree, although I am not sure whether Zak will be overall coach or bowling coach. The man is full of knowledge and skill. Plus, he is someone who prefers to do the job by being in the background," Gambhir wrote in his Hindustan Times column.

"I have known Zak for long to declare that his skills with the ball are par excellence. The way he chokes his victims is exemplary. I am not sure if he is keen given his other engagements, but I won’t look too far if he is interested for the coach’s job," the KKR skipper further added.
